About Deanna

Why do about pages always feel so hard to write? Slightly more than five decades on this planet and all of the experiences and roles that go with that are impossible to capture fully in a few paragraphs, aren't they? Cheers to trying to give you an idea of who I am through these words! 


As of 2018, you'll find me walking around the Jamaican countryside with an umbrella to give me refuge from the Caribbean sun and rain and sometimes using it to remind the mongrel dogs that we need to coexist in peace and harmony.


I spent more than three decades of my life over-giving without boundaries and forgetting to take care of myself while doing it, so I burned out and left a successful twenty-year career in public education to meet myself and create a life I didn't want to escape from. Jamaica has been one of my greatest teachers.


I love a cup of strong, black coffee in the morning while I read a library book, write in my journal, and draw in my sketchbook. Slow mornings are a beloved ritual that I protect rather fiercely and even after eight years of having them, the novelty hasn't worn off. 


When I was a child growing up in a lot of dysfunction and darkness, I wished so badly that magic was real and I privately cried big, juicy tears when I realized that the Easter Bunny was never going to bring me a real bunny. When I was in high school, I got that bunny, and I went on to have a few more after that one. Now I like to dream up magical worlds in my sketchbook and journal, and I'm currently dreaming up a magical island for the children's book characters I created, Jack N' Birdie, who were inspired by the birth of my grandson, Jack, in 2024.  


I think a lot, I draw a lot, and I do both to stay in conversation and presence with life. In recent years, I've begun to more boldly share my creative work because I want desperately for human created art and books to stay alive in this modern world where so much is outsourced to technology and robots and I want to contribute how I can. 


I love the smell of libraries and books. I eat dessert just about every day, and I finally care more about feeling good in my body than getting fat. Sometimes I am super chatty, and sometimes I go days without talking to anyone but my husband and dogs because I deeply love being alone and staring into space. I used to want to be an astronaut, and when I unexpectedly became a special education teacher, I figured it was a little bit like being in outer space every day anyway. 


I continue to hold out hope and root for humanity, and I feel called to do what I can to relieve suffering in myself and others. Everything that I offer from my services to my writing, to my art, is grounded in love and intended as an offering to cultivate peace, calm, and relieve suffering.
